小麦不同种植密度及种植方式对杂草生长的控制作用研究

ROLES OF WHEAT SEEDING RATE AND ROW SPACING IN WEED CONTROL.

【摘要】 田间试验结果表明:小麦种植密度与杂草发生量关系密切。等行距种植时,小麦播种量由2.5kg/亩提高到12.5kg/亩,越年生、早春性及晚春性杂草发生数量分别降低0、70.3%和83.6%,越年生及早春性杂草鲜重降低81.1%;小麦三密一稀种植时杂草发生量稍多于相同密度下等行距种植的杂草发生量。小麦-玉米两熟农田,增加小麦播量至12.5kg/以上,后茬免耕种植玉米时可不用喷施灭生性除草剂农达,仅用40%乙阿合剂FL150ml/亩就能达理想除草效果,这在一定程度上节省了除草剂用量。

【Abstract】 Field experiment was conducted in 1997- 1998 on wheat seeding rate and row spacing in weed control.Density of bianual(flixweed and shepherdspure) early spring emerged(lambsquaters) and late spring emerged weeds(crabgrass,goose grass,redroot pigweed etc) decreased by 0,70.3%and83.6%respectively while fresh weight of bianual and early spring emerged weeds decreased by 81.1%as wheat seeding rate increased from 2.5 kg/mu to 12.5 kg/mu.More weeds emerged when wheat was planted in two narrow rows(row spacing 15cm) and one wide row(row spacing 30cm) than it planted in20 cm row spacing.Excellent weed control efficacy was achieved only by applying 150ml/mu 40%atrazine plus acetochlar in no tillage corn plots planted after 12.5 kg/mu wheat needing rate plots,while150ml/mu 40%atrazine plus acetochlar tank mixing 150ml/mu 41%roundup should be applied in no tillage corn plots planted after 2.5kg/mu wheat seeding rate plots.
